Tony Hutter
Tony Hutter
Note that we have recently merged https://github.com/openzfs/zfs/pull/17780 which might help with some of these cases.
Related: https://github.com/openzfs/zfs/issues/264 https://github.com/openzfs/zfs/pull/7545
Does f7d8b1333699957de59d72fc57c9a771951f6582 fix the build?
>> Does [f7d8b13](https://github.com/openzfs/zfs/commit/f7d8b1333699957de59d72fc57c9a771951f6582) fix the build? > Tested against linux-6.9.8-gentoo and worked fine. Thanks. I've included that patch in the upcoming zfs-2.2.5 release (https://github.com/openzfs/zfs/pull/16359).
@Harry-Chen thank you for the info! Looks like s390 ZFS users may want to skip the 6.10 kernel until the fix lands.
Forgot to mention this earlier - can you add a test case to exercise `zpool scrub -S|-E`? Please include all weird edge cases, like invalid dates/ranges, setting timezones forward/backwards, and...
> This will create very long test. Do you have some suggestions? The test case could temporarily set the system clock forward to simulate the passage of time.
@adamdmoss that's a good point. @pcd1193182 what are your thoughts on disabling all channel programs on Apple silicon until we get a real fix?
@pcd1193182 can you give some more detail on the problem you're seeing? Is it a test-case problem, or a real problem with lua on Apple silicon?
>> You can't currently disable channel programs; snapshot destruction requires it (see dsl_destroy_snapshots_nvl()). > It's a real problem; if you try to run any lua program that triggers an exception...